Action item from the Fenwick Components postmortem: our shared library, Quiltkit, got a breaking change shipped as a patch release, which is how three downstream teams ended up with mismatched button props on the same day. Going forward, any export signature change must bump the major version, no exceptions, and the release manager signs off before publish. We've also turned on the semver linter in CI so this is caught automatically. The full versioning policy and sign-off checklist live on the page below.

wiki page, fajof-tajef: https://vault.tolvaqio.corp/board/pipeline/pages/ticket/c20d7f984bcc9e12

Over the past three weeks, humidity readings in the Larkfield pilot house have drifted roughly 4% from the reference probes, and the controller has been over-venting as a result. Root cause appears to be stale calibration offsets that were never rolled forward after the 2.3 firmware push, so the deployed config no longer matches what release notes claim. Please hold the next release until this is reconciled. For reference, the controller is currently running with the following configuration values.

deployment values, yadug-bawif:
[framir]
team = pelox
access_code = ac_a38ab2
owner = tamion.julael
host = framir.tolvaqlabs.test
port = 11211
peer = tammir.zemvargrid.local
salt = 2215ef03
pin = 1541

/*
 * Plugin authors: this constant controls how SyncMeadow resolves
 * calendar conflicts when two sources claim the same slot. The host
 * app always wins ties; plugins may only lower, never raise, their
 * own priority. Changing this value in a fork will desync badly
 * against upstream servers, so don't. The value is validated at
 * build time against the host manifest. The expected check token
 * for this build follows below.
 */

session token of tajef-bageg = htk21_5d90d574934f3ccae6437